Configuring email alert settings
You can configure the email address to receive the email alerts. Also, configure the SMTP server address settings.
NOTE: If your mail server is Microsoft Exchange Server 2007, make sure that iDRAC domain name is configured for the
mail server to receive the email alerts from iDRAC.
NOTE: Email alerts support both IPv4 and IPv6 addresses. The DRAC DNS Domain Name must be specified when using
IPv6.

Configuring email alert settings using web interface
To configure the email alert settings using Web interface:
1. Go to Overview > Server > Alerts > SNMP and Email Settings .
2. Select the State option to enable the email address to receive the alerts and type a valid email address. For more
information about the options, see the iDRAC Online Help.
3. Click Send under Test Email to test the configured email alert settings.
4. Click Apply.
Configuring email alert settings using RACADM
1. To enable email alert:
racadm set iDRAC.EmailAlert.Enable.[index] [n]

2. To configure email settings:
racadm set iDRAC.EmailAlert.Address.[index] [email-address]
